there is no light in them Isa 8.20 And doth not all Scripture plainly affirm and the Churches and Martyrs and Witnesses of Truth all along affirm That Christ hath a true humane body He could not properly arise nor ascend but in his flesh and is he not for ever God revealed in the flesh 1 Tim. 3.16 and after his Glorification is he not called 1 Tim. 2.5 The man Christ Jesus and the Rev. 13.5,6 Tabernacle of God by reason of the flesh Rev. 13.5,6 and in whom the Godhead is said to dwell bodily for the same cause Col. 1. is he not said to have a life given him for ever and ever Isa 53.10 Psal 21.4 Rev. 1.18 And if he had not carried his real body into Heaven he would have left it in the Grave behinde he would not have eaten and drunken in it for to shew the reality of his body and that he was no spirit as the Disciples imagined he would not have offered his body to be handled the print of the nails to be felt for the proof of the truth and reality thereof And that he shall visibly appear again unto the world it appeareth Because the same body he carried up with the same he must return again to Judgement Psa 110.1 Acts 3. and therefore it is said Acts 17.31 He hath appointed a day wherein he will judge the world by that MAN whom he hath ordained It is a sick and irksom labor to multiply places about a point so clear But what Scripture or Reason hath shewed you That his second coming is his coming in his Saints a mystical coming The plain words of Scripture are ever against you neither can they be applied otherwise then by making them a nose of wax This Jesus whom you have seen going into heaven shall so come as ye have seen Acts 1. I saw a white throne and one sate thereon Rev. 20.11 Behold he cometh with clouds Rev. 1. Matth. 24. 25. If you turn these things into Allegories nothing can be certain And would not Christ and his Apostles have told us so in some place or other if this coming were onely figurative adde That if this be figurative other things annexed are also figurative and nothing plain and this were to make a chaos and confusion of the Scriptures It grieveth me to spend time when matters are so evident Of like nature is that which you grosly hold that There is no Resurrection of the body Read 1 Cor. 15. Dan. 12.2 Rev. 20.12,13,14 It irketh me to write in such cases Whereas you say The Saints are Christ one with God their Being God What godly ear can hear such things without defiance and abomination If Saints are so if you are so then are you without sin as Christ Omnipotent Omniscient Infinite to be worshipped and adored as God and Christ is I will spit at this and say no more I understand also that you can determine of the holy Scriptures that much of them is written with a humane spirit can take or take not for Scripture or meaning of Scripture onely by the Rule of an apprehension and Revelation of the Spirit which you suppose your self to be guided by and to have more of then the Apostles had The same Spirit which told you that much of the Scripture was written with a humane Spirit may haply tell you at another time that all the Scripture is written with a humane Spirit that there is no certainty therein yield to one yield to all But we know that the Prophets and Apostles did all write as guided by the Spirit of God 2 Pet. 1. ult 2 Pet. 3. Now over and above all this there are other horrid things in your Book which I have not seen and Satan hath been let loose to shut you up and to imprison you in your monstrous Heresies by gates and bars and to fetter and chain you up that all means might be frustrate whereby we might have hope to bring you forth For if any thing from Scripture or Reason is brought against your Opinions which you cannot answer you can shift it off with this That you do not so apprehend thinking your apprehension to be infallible and above Reason or Scripture How came you by such an apprehension By what means came you to know that it is infallibly directed or may you not be praefident in thinking it to be so when it is not But surely no Saint or Martyr since the Apostles ever challenged to themselves such an apprehension for ought I finde And we are all commanded to regulate our apprehensions by the Scripture and not to judge the Scriptures by ungrounded apprehensions Thy word is a light unto my paths Psal 119. 2 Pet. 2. Mat. 4. for otherwise any Heretique may justifie himself by his apprehension and there would be no way to confute Error The Apostles themselves though infallibly directed yet would subject their Doctrine to the tryal of the Scripture as in the Bereans and prove it unto others by the Scripture Rom. 9. Furthermore in these days we cannot tell That our apprehensions are guided by the Spirit but by the light of Scripture You will say It is so with you but how will you prove it to your self or others why may it not be the Spirit of Satan which you think to be the Spirit of God I dare be bold to say It is the Spirit of Satan and not of God that so directeth apprehensions as not under the direction of the Word Dear Sister with whom I have had sweet communion in the ways of God let us not now part at last divided in Faith Eternally divided Were you not in the Faith before you fell into these Opinions and did you not then write unto me that you had full Assurance Is all then lost and nothing that was before that you have changed your Faith and your Religion Is the Doctrine of your Reverend Father and of Dr. Twisse and the Doctrine of the holy Martyrs now at last discovered to be Error whom the Apocalyps doth expresly stile the Witnesses of Truth Whither will you run dear Sister from your Parents Friends Church Christ God and life Eternal Have you no more strength but at the first assault to yield the Bucklers and to give over your Faith so long professed at the first push If you had not Reason enough your self yet why did you not first enquire of those that might have holpen you I would rather a hundred times you had perished by the Sword then have thus faln dishonored God and your Profession and weakened the people of the Lord and shamed all your Friends and laid up treasures of Correction for your Posterity and put your self in a suspitious way at least of losing the heavenly Inheritance Let me tell you plainly I doubt there was some grievous sin at bottom as the Pride of Women or Spiritual Pride or something
